Artist Shirley Calhoun Williams
Shirley Williams, Oil Painter, Mixed Media Artist, Photographer. Shirley is a native of Gaston Co... She comes from a family of artist, the late Ira Calhoun her father, along with her siblings. She is currently studying fine arts at Gaston Community College. She studied photography there also. Her art has hung in various galleries including Jeanne Rauch Gallery, Shield Museum, Stowe Botanical Gardens, Southern Arts Gallery, Visual Arts Gallery, and other businesses. Williams was chosen for ( North Carolina State Community college ) President's Choice Awards Show, to represent Gaston College for the years 2003, 2004, and 2005. Williams is currently displaying several pieces for Jim Long at the North Carolina State Insurance Building in Raleigh. Her art hangs in Public and private collections as well as university collections. She credits the work of Vincent Van Gough, Jean-François Millet, Jean-Leon Gerome, Claude Monet, Jed Jackson, Beth Edwards, Gary Freeman, and Jason Story with influencing her style.
